Transaction 5bfac0134535709ce12237f8757f98c58966a02e077b0bda00329b301a2e8dd0
1 Input
1 Output
-
5bfac0134535709ce12237f8757f98c58966a02e077b0bda00329b301a2e8dd0:0
- value
- 106308
- script pubkey
- OP_0 OP_PUSHBYTES_32 c8312f3aad20f2a89ace19f9b65ebe4318c0be4532d90721a4492c10303cf84f
- address
- bc1qeqcj7w4dyre23xkwr8umvh47gvvvp0j9xtvswgdyfykpqvpulp8spm8853